Understanding AEDs: What Are They?

Automated External Defibrillators are portable gadgets that diagnose dangerous arrhythmias and deliver electric shocks to recover a regular heart rhythm. These gadgets are developed with user-friendliness in mind, making them available even for those without clinical training.

How Do AEDs Work?

Activation: When you turn on the gadget, it carries out a self-check. Analysis: The AED analyzes the heart's rhythm. Instructions: It supplies distinct instructions assisting the user via each step. Shock Delivery: If required, it triggers you to provide a shock to the patient.

Why Are AEDs Important for Children?

Cardiac apprehension in kids is uncommon however can take place because of congenital heart defects, trauma, or sinking cases. Quick access to an AED can substantially enhance survival prices in such situations.

How to Utilize an AED Step by Step in Australia

When faced with an emergency situation entailing a kid, understanding just how to use an AED is essential:

Call Emergency Services: Dial 000 immediately. Check Responsiveness: Delicately shake the youngster and shout. Start CPR: Begin CPR if less competent and not breathing normally. Retrieve the AED: Obtain the nearby available AED. Turn On the Device: Adhere to voice motivates carefully. Attach Pads: Place pads according to layouts offered; one on the upper body and one on the back if handling children or infants. Analyze Rhythm: Enable the gadget to evaluate; do not touch the kid during this process. Deliver Shock if Advised: If triggered by the tool, make certain nobody touches the kid and press shock button.

AED Use on Kid Australia

In Australia, details pediatric pads are readily available that are designed for children under eight years old or evaluating less than 25 kg (55 pounds). Constantly examine your neighborhood standards concerning ideal equipment.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Can I use a grown-up AED on a child?

Yes! Adult-sized pads can be utilized on older youngsters who evaluate greater than 25 kg (55 lbs). For infants or young children under this weight restriction, it's advisable to make use of pediatric pads if available.

2. How rapidly do I require to use an AED after heart attack occurs?

Immediate activity is essential; preferably within minutes of collapse-- every minute without CPR minimizes survival chances by roughly 10%.

3. What need to I do if multiple individuals are around during a cardiac emergency?

Assign functions-- one person should call for help (dialing 000), an additional ought to get the AED while someone else initiates CPR.
